Handover Note — Regional Sales Review

To the finance team: I'm passing the southern region review from my desk to Director Halvesen. Q2 figures for the Corvella and Dunmarsh territories are reconciled; Q3 accruals remain open pending distributor rebates. Please route variance queries to Halvesen's office from Monday. Context on where this review is heading sits in the confidential note below.

internal memo for yahof-bajop: Tamethox Group is in early talks to buy Ulamirek Group for about $64.0 million. The Aldiel launch date is October 11, and nothing goes to the press before then.

Welcome aboard. The Tilewarm service predicts which map tiles a user will need next and warms the edge cache ahead of pan and zoom gestures. It consumes viewport telemetry, scores candidate tiles with a simple decay model, and issues batched fetches with strict rate limits so we never starve live requests. Most contractor tasks involve tuning the scoring weights or adding metrics, not touching the fetch pipeline itself. Architecture diagrams, the scoring model notes, and local setup instructions are on the page below.

wiki page, bajog-tahop: https://confluence.qorvelsys.internal/browse/pages/pages/pages

# strpull: Limits and Quotas

The `strpull` extraction script scans the Veldway app tree for translatable strings before each release cut. Hard limits: it aborts past a file-count ceiling, truncates strings over a byte cap, and rate-limits writes to the catalog service. Exceeding any limit fails the release gate; no partial catalogs ship. Raise limits only with sign-off from the localization lead. The enforced constants are listed below.

tuning table, yajog-yahof:
BUDGETS = {
    "lamvan": 303,
    "wenox": 460,
    "fenvan": 525,
}

Subject: Scanner integration update for plugin authors

The Quintarra barcode scanner bridge now normalizes all symbology identifiers before invoking plugin hooks, so plugins no longer need their own prefix-stripping logic. Legacy raw-mode hooks remain supported through the next two releases. Please validate your plugins against the candidate build identified below.

pipeline stamp: htk6_c0ef30